Address: Derby, KS 67037, USA
“McConnell AFB FamCamp I There are 10 pull through spaces in FamCamp I, full hookups, picnic table and fire pit at each pad. No problem with 30 amp hookup for the week we were here. There is a run/walking path, fishing ponds, lots of space and pavilions in this tucked away oasis near the Outdoor Rec Office. Occasionally a refueler comes or goes from the runway but I was surprised by how noise level was low. I enjoyed watching the big birds do touch and go. The facilities are easy to access. The Dining Facility is great and open to all. We loved it here during our week visiting family on Wichita. Lovely setting and peaceful, well maintained site.”

Address: 957 FM985, Ennis, TX 75119, USA
“I read several negative reviews on this park before visiting and after staying for the night I really don't understand why. I would give it a true 3.5 rating. It is not as nice as a state park, yet not as bad as some of the KOA parks we have stayed. The park is nice for local boaters and has a swimming area. The restrooms were clean and had hot water. (The shower pressure could be a little stronger, but definitely met our needs). The park was pretty quiet after 10 p.m. and we slept well. We saw local police patroling throughout the park several times, which is a plus for safety. Our site was: level, had a covered picnic table, a grill, a fire pit, electrical hook up, and water spicket. We would definitely stay again if we were passing through.”
